Today’s episode is with Sophie Krantz. Sophie Krantz is an advisor, coach and speaker on internationalisation, global strategic expansion, and international leadership development. In over 20 countries, Sophie has worked with private public sector leaders to develop and implement international business strategies. Sophie has done this at Global Fortune 500 and ASX100 companies as well as with startup founders and CEOs of SMEs and scaleups. Sophie has held internationalisation strategy roles, including at the International Trade Centre (agency of the UN/WTO) in Geneva and at Swiss Re in Zurich. Enabling her clients to adapt to global opportunities and risks associated with the Digital Era and Fourth Industrial Revolution, Sophie applies the Exponential Organisation framework, designed by Salim Ismail, in her work. Sophie runs workshops and masterclasses for international business leaders. Her work centres on creating the connections, content and conversations for business leaders and companies to succeed on the world stage.

In today’s podcast, Sophie discusses not only how she got to where she is, but also how to adapt to a more globalised world. She breaks down how standing still can be as dangerous as trying something new, why your friends should be changing, and how to develop globalised networks.
